New servers and expected service breaks

For the past months we’ve been busy building a new backend (servers and databases, that is) for Sports Tracker. As Sports Tracker has become more and more popular, our old servers just couldn’t handle the huge amount of users we have today. The new backend system will be taken into use today and tuned for optimal performance gradually during the upcoming weeks.

We will have a scheduled service break starting today, Tuesday 24th of September, at 11am CET/ 2am PT. The break is estimated to take 48 hours but we will keep you informed about the progress. We also expect to have a few short delays or service breaks during the upcoming weeks as we fine-tune the performance. It is also possible that momentarily the service will not show all your historical data, but don’t worry – all your workouts are safe.

What does then the new backend mean to you as a user? Basically it means the service will be more stable and faster. There are also many other technical improvements to the service. As many of you know, we’ve had to prioritize this work and many other projects have been postponed. Now that we’ll have the new backend in place, we can start the work on those projects.   19. MikeJ

    I use the App almost every day. I have not noticed issues with uploading to the website. It works as promised.
    The one thing I run into is that after a GOOD run, I sometimes forget to turn it off and I track my drive home. I later try to use the clean feature to remove the spike, but it tells me that I am trying to delete too many data points, so I end up deleting the entire run. I know this is user error and not with the app itself. Just bringing it to your attention in case there is anything you can do to help a forgetful person like myself

    1. jmccabe

      Hi MikeJ

      For the moment what I would suggest you do in those cases is look at the workout online and check what time you finished it. Then export the workout and save it locally. You can then edit the file (workout.gpx I think) in a text editor (e.g. notepad++ may be ok, or Emacs – it needs to be something that understands Unix format line endings so Notepad won’t do) and remove the bits from that point on. If you look in the file you’ll see a load of:

      sections. All you need to do is remove those for the section when you were in the car making sure you only go as far as the just above (i.e. DO NOT REMOVE THE line). Save the modified file.

      Then you can delete the original from the website and use the import facility to pull in the changed workout from the file.

      Hope this helps.
      John

      1. jmccabe

        Aaarrggh – it’s got rid of the XML stuff!! Ah well..

        Above should say: “If you look in the file you’ll see a load of (in this section, to avoid XML being removed, I’ve replace the “<" with ordinary brackets i.e. "(")

        (trkpt lat="xxx" lon="yyy")
        (other elements….)
        (/trkpt)
        sections. All you need to do….. (as above)

        Then "only go as far as the (/trkpt) just above (/trkseg) (i.e. DO NOT REMOVE THE (/trkseg) line). Save the modified file."…

        Hope this helps more :-)
        John
